Introduction
Congratulations on your purchase of the KAVAN R6, a 6-channel telemetry receiver. It operates on ACCESS transmission system and has 6 high-precision PWM channels and 16 or 24-channel modes using S.BUS. Two detachable antennas with IPEX4 connectors provide full signal strength throughout the range. It's especially perfect for gliders, but you can use it for a variety of other models as well. Thanks to its small size and lightweight, it is also suitable for small models. With redundancy support, it can be connected as a primary receiver via S.BUS. Thanks to the F.BUS connection option, you can also pair it quickly and easily to several different telemetry devices.
